Jeongdong Theater

Opened in 1995, the Jeongdong Theater in Seoul stands as the first modern theater in Korea, seating an intimate audience of 282. Despite its modest size, it has made a significant impact on the Korean performing arts scene. The theater hosts a diverse array of live performances, from traditional Korean song and dance to contemporary works. Visitors can experience a rich tapestry of cultural expressions, making it a notable destination for those interested in both classical and modern Korean arts.
